Stun Device Battery Life: Understanding The Factors Affecting Durability
Stun device battery life is a key consideration for anyone looking to purchase such a tool, as it directly impacts the durability and reliability of the device when in need. Several factors affect a stun gun’s battery longevity. First, the quality and type of battery play a significant role; high-quality lithium-ion batteries generally offer superior performance and longer lifespan compared to other types.
Second, usage frequency and intensity matter. Regular use will naturally deplete the battery faster, especially if each deployment requires a lengthy discharge. Additionally, environmental conditions can influence battery life, with extreme temperatures affecting both charge retention and overall performance. Longevity And Maintenance: Maximizing The Lifespan Of Your Stun Gun Battery
The longevity of a stun gun battery is a critical factor for any user, especially considering how vital it is to have a reliable device in an emergency situation. While modern stun guns boast advanced technology and improved battery life, regular maintenance plays a significant role in maximizing its lifespan. Regularly inspecting the battery health and following proper care practices can extend its serviceable years.
Unlike certain devices, stun guns are designed not to cause permanent damage when used correctly, but it’s essential to understand that excessive use or poor maintenance might reduce battery life. Users should familiarize themselves with the device’s charging instructions, avoid overcharging, and ensure they follow the manufacturer’s guidelines for storage. By adopting these simple measures, you can help prolong the battery life of your stun gun, ensuring its reliability when it matters most.
